i think theres something you lose when you develop practical skill at art where you just cannot draw like really good bad drawings. like its forced, your learned grasp on anatomy and line doesnt go away. youre too caught in it, it controls ever line you make, you cant fully force yourself to discard it. even trying your hardest you cant accomplish that earlier state, you can only badly mimic it
and like im not saying “ungnghfhjjhhdh im so good i cant even draw badly if i wanted to!!” because that is like the opposite of what i mean, i mean like no matter how much i do, how much i grow and accomplish, nothing i will EVER make will even begin to compare to the raw feeling captured in this image
